I was looking at budget models for the parents, came down to four choices and the Compaq was cheapest and quickest for games but no inbuilt wireless, but Dell was most configurable with options. Details below:
* After $100 cashback Columns refer to the following: Brand Model Price CPU Memory Hard Disk Video LCD Resolution Wireless Warranty Weight DVD/CD ------------- Compaq Presario V2627AU $786* 1.8ghz Sempron (AMD) 1x512mb 40gb (4200rpm) ATI Radeon® Xpress 200 14” Wide screen 1280*800 NO 1 year 2.4kgs CDRW/DVD ROM --------------- Acer Aspire 3624WXCi $789* 1.6ghz Celeron (Intel) 1x256mb 40gb (?rpm) Intel® 910GML 192mb shared 14.1” Wide screen 1280*800 Yes 1 year 2kgs CDRW/DVD ROM --------- Toshiba Satellite Pro A100 $990.00 1.4ghz Celeron (Intel) 1x256mb 40gb (5400rpm) ATI Radeon® Xpress 200 64mb shared 15.4” Wide screen 1280*800 Yes 1 year 2.7kgs CDRW/DVD ROM ------ Dell Inspiron 1300 $799.00 1.5ghz Celeron (Intel) 1x256mb [1x512mb for $55] 40gb (5400rpm) [60gb for $29] Intel Media Accelerator 900mb 128 shared 14.1” Wide screen [15.4” for $33 extra] 1280*800 Yes 1 year 2.9kgs CDRW/DVD ROM [8X DVD for $48] $964 with above options |
